the commandline uploader [up2k.py](https://github.com/9001/copyparty/tree/hovudstraum/bin#up2kpy) with `--dr` is the best way to sync a folder to copyparty; verifies checksums and does files in parallel, and deletes unexpected files on the server after upload has finished which makes file-renames really cheap (it'll rename serverside and skip uploading)
alternatively there is [rclone](./docs/rclone.md) which allows for bidirectional sync and is *way* more flexible (stream files straight from sftp/s3/gcs to copyparty for instance), although there is no integrity check and it won't work with files over 100 MiB if copyparty is behind cloudflare
